Understanding the Telc B1 Certificate
Telc (The European Language Certificates) is a globally recognized provider of language examinations. The B1 level, specifically, lines up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). At this level, a speaker is thought about "independent." They can comprehend the main points of clear standard input on familiar matters routinely encountered in work, school, and leisure.
Why is the B1 Level Crucial?
In Germany, the B1 certificate is an obligatory requirement for several legal procedures:

To successfully get the certificate, candidates must pass both the written and oral elements of the exam. The exam is designed to evaluate 4 core competencies: Reading, Listening, Writing, and Speaking.
Comprehensive Exam BreakdownModulePartPeriodFocusWritten ExamReading & & Language Elements90 MinutesUnderstanding and GrammarListening30 MinutesUnderstanding spoken dialogueComposing30 MinutesFormal/Informal letter or emailOral ExamSpeaking15 MinutesIntro, Topic Conversation, Planning1. The Composed Assessment
The written portion begins with reading understanding. Candidates exist with numerous texts, such as ads, paper articles, and informational pamphlets, followed by multiple-choice or true/false questions. This is followed by a "Language Elements" area which focuses particularly on grammar and vocabulary in context.

The listening area requires candidates to draw out information from public statements, radio reports, or table talks. Finally, the writing section jobs the prospect with responding to a particular situation-- normally a letter of problem or a questions-- emphasizing right tone and structure.
2. The Oral Assessment
The oral exam is generally carried out in pairs or groups of 3. This area evaluates the prospect's capability to communicate with complete confidence and react to a partner. It includes a self-introduction, a conversation based on a brief text, and a collective job where prospects should prepare an event together.

How long is the Telc B1 certificate legitimate?
The Telc B1 certificate itself does not end. However, some institutions or immigration authorities might request a certificate that disappears than 2 or 3 years old to guarantee your language skills are present.
2. What takes place if I fail one part of the exam?
If a candidate passes the oral area but fails the composed section (or vice versa), they only require to retake the failed part. This credit is usually legitimate up until completion of the following calendar year.
3. Can I take the Telc B1 examination online?
As of present policies, the main Telc B1 test should be taken in person at a licensed screening center to make sure the stability and security of the screening environment.
4. Is Telc better than the Goethe-Zertifikat?
Both are similarly acknowledged by German authorities. The main difference depends on the exam format and the availability of testing dates. Numerous find the Telc format slightly more "real-world" focused, while Goethe is frequently viewed as more academic.
5. What is a passing score?
To pass, a prospect must achieve at least 60% of the maximum possible points in both the composed and oral parts of the evaluation.
